MFC 在類嚮導中新增不顯示的類

2021-06-02 10:23:04 字數 685 閱讀 4326

當mfc classwizard中class name列表中,若沒有已經新增到工程的視窗類,可以通過以下方式新增:

1, 在工程的clw檔案中新增cdlgshow類索引,如下:

然後,在工程中,再次開啟view->classwizard類嚮導,然後選中class name列表中找到剛新增的型別,若cdlgshow類符合mfc類的格式,就能正常顯示並新增相關的處理方法,若不符合mfc類格式,則會給出提示,然後選擇正確的cdlgshow的頭和原始檔即可。

備註:若要修改mfc的類名,要修改完整,比如以下幾個地方要記得替換完全:

.h檔案中

// dialog data

//}afx_data

// overrides

// classwizard generated virtual function overrides

//}afx_virtual

// generated message map functions

//}afx_msg

.cpp檔案中

begin_message_map(cdlgshow, cdialog)

//}afx_msg_map

end_message_map()

MFC中顯示IplImage類

平常使用opencv顯示影象時總是跳出乙個個視窗,這樣很難與mfc繼承,而在opencv提供的cvvimage類中很好的使mfc中顯示iplimage類的。cvvimage類在opencv的highgui.h標頭檔案中被宣告 在opencv2.0以後的版本中,這個類好像被去掉了,顯得非常不方便,可以...

在MFC程式中新增全屏顯示功能

這是工作室為實現全屏顯示所髮集的乙個演示程式。你可以通過選擇全屏顯示選單選項時看到相應的效果。這段 包括兩個內容 全屏顯示,浮動工具條 用於恢復操作 下圖便是全屏狀態和用於切換的浮動工具條 具體實現步驟 以下的 被新增到cmainframe類中。這裡是使用到的四個訊息以及他們的簡要說明 1 onvi...

在MFC程式中新增全屏顯示功能

這是工作室為實現全屏顯示所髮集的乙個演示程式。你可以通過選擇全屏顯示選單選項時看到相應的效果。這段 包括兩個內容 全屏顯示,浮動工具條 用於恢復操作 以下的 被新增到cmainframe類中。這裡是使用到的四個訊息以及他們的簡要說明 1 onviewfullscreen 全屏顯示選單項的控制代碼。2...